Deep Foundation Repair in Columbus, OH
Deep foundation repair services address iss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ve diagnosing foundation problems caused by soil movement, settling, or other structural shifts, and then implementing solutions such as underpinning, piering, or stabilization. Projects may include repairing cracked or bowed basement walls, leveling uneven floors, or reinforcing foundations affected by shifting soil or water damage. Property owners often seek these services to prevent further structural deterioration, protect their investment, and ensure the safety of the building’s occupants.
Before requesting deep foundation repair, property owners usually want to understand the signs of foundation problems, such as visible cracks, uneven flooring, or doors and windows that don’t close properly. It’s also important to consider the extent of the damage and potential causes, as well as the types of repair methods suitable for the specific situation. Clear communication about the scope of work, potential costs, and long-term stability can help homeowners make informed decisions about addressing foundation concerns effectively.

Common Deep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ation underpinning - stabilizes and strengthens existing foundations to prevent further settling.
Pile driving - installs deep support piers to carry heavy loads and improve stability.
Slab stabilization - lifts and levels uneven concrete slabs to eliminate trip hazards.
Pier and beam repair - reinforces or replaces supporting piers and beams for a secure foundation.
Soil stabilization - improves soil conditions around the foundation to reduce shifting and settling.
Foundation reinforcement - adds structural support to enhance the durability of the foundation.
Deep Foundation Repair Questions
What types of foundation issues require repair? Common signs include uneven floors, cracked walls, and sticking doors or windows, indicating potential foundation problems needing attention.
How do deep foundation repairs improve property stability? They strengthen the foundation by addressing underlying soil or structural issues, helping to prevent further damage and maintain the property's integrity.
What methods are used for deep foundation repair? Techniques such as underpinning, pier installation, and soil stabilization are used to reinforce and stabilize the foundation effectively.
What should property owners consider before a foundation repair project? It's important to assess the extent of the damage, understand the repair options, and ensure proper soil and structural evaluation for long-term stability.
